History
Tomioka Hachiman-gu has long been cherished as the guardian deity of Fukutawa since ancient Edo. It enshrines Emperor Ojin as its principal deity and is known for the Fukutawa Festival, one of the three great festivals of Edo. It has particularly deep connections to sumo wrestling, and in the Edo period, official tournaments were held within the shrine grounds, with monuments dedicated to successive yokozuna still standing. Gathering the faith of merchants and craftspeople, this is a venerable shrine that has thrived as a source of support for the hearts of Edo people.
